Here's a list of the Top 40 foods for your brain (high in anti-oxidants)
(the anti-oxidant capacity of each appears after each)
- prunes - 5770
- raisins - 2830
- blueberries - 2234
- blackberries - 2036
- garlic - 1939
- kale - 1770
- cranberries - 1750
- strawberries - 1536
- spinach, raw - 1210
- raspberries - 1227
- brussel sprouts - 1123
- plum - 949
- alfalfa sprouts - 931
- spinach, steamed - 909
- broccoli - 888
- beets - 841
- avocado - 782
- orange - 750
- grapes, red - 739
- pepper, red - 731
-
cherries - 670
kiwifruit - 602
baked beans - 503
pink grapefruit - 483
-
kidney beans - 460
onion - 449
white grapes - 446
corn - 402
eggplant - 386
cauliflower - 377
frozen peas - 364
potatoes - 313
sweet potatoes - 313
red cabbage - 298
leaf lettuce - 262
cantaloupe - 252
banana - 221
apple - 218
tofu - 213
- carrots - 207 OK the number formatting didn't work but you get the idea!
